Hi all,

Today's linux-next merge of the kvm-arm tree got a conflict in:

  arch/arm64/include/asm/cpufeature.h
  arch/arm64/kernel/cpufeature.c

between commit:

  d5370f754875 ("arm64: prefetch: add alternative pattern for CPUs without a 
prefetcher")
  57f4959bad0a ("arm64: kernel: Add support for User Access Override")
  705441960033 ("arm64: kernel: Don't toggle PAN on systems with UAO")

from the arm64 tree and commit:

  d0be74f771d5 ("arm64: Add ARM64_HAS_VIRT_HOST_EXTN feature")

from the kvm-arm tree.

I fixed it up (see below) and can carry the fix as necessary (no action
is required).
